Transaction 3fb89ca86a6e4496b007d787097a2056392025ca9fc0a335129a162d74a2fd02
1 Input
1 Output
-
3fb89ca86a6e4496b007d787097a2056392025ca9fc0a335129a162d74a2fd02:0
- value
- 1702538
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ea1cbcb90cc532409e7f154caf9cde0c4af87607 OP_EQUAL
- address
- 3P2tU8MdK3NiQStm4A88AqUBWa8PqyBdaQ